Vedanta hikes its aluminium ingot price by INR 1,250/t with effect from January 6

Vedanta has increased its aluminium products price for the second time in a row. With effect from Wednesday, 06 January 2021, the prices of some aluminium ingots are in the range of INR 171,250-184,250 per tonne. This marks an increase of INR 1,250 per tonne from INR 170,000-183,000 per tonne on January 05.

Billet price has climbed by INR 1,250 per tonne to stand at INR 179,250 per tonne as of Wednesday, 06 January 2021. The price was INR 178,000 per tonne on January 05.
The Indian aluminium producers generally link prices of its products to the three-month futures of aluminium on London Metal Exchange. The aluminium price on LME has been increasing since October.
Vedanta’s aluminium business typically accounts for one-third of the company’s consolidated sales. Vedanta has a stake in Bharat Aluminium Co Ltd and smelters at Jharsuguda in Odisha. It commands a 40% share in India's primary aluminium market.
